Utility of VEGF mimetic QK Peptide in a Novel Library of Injectable Hydrogels to Promote Vascularization

摘要

Conclusions: A critical factor in vascularization is to mimic the essentials biophysical and biochemical cues within the native tissue microenvironment. In this work, we developed a novel injectable hydrogel containing vasculogenic QK peptide, mimicking the helical structures at the binding sites of VEGF, to promote vascularization within the 3D microenvironment of the hydrogel matrix. Our future work will be focused on assessment of the utility of the proposed matrices in promoting vascular formation in vivo.
